West Chicago police arrest two charged with firing weapons from apartment balcony
Two men face weapons charges after shooting firearms while standing on the second-floor balcony of a West Chicago apartment building, police said.
Tory Boynton, 27, of Elgin, and Lewis McCracken, 26, of West Chicago, are charged with felon in possession of or use of a weapon or firearm, according to West Chicago police. Both appeared Friday in DuPage County bond court, where bail was set at $75,000 for Boynton and $50,000 for McCracken.
West Chicago police officers responded to reports of shots fired in the 400 block of Carriage Drive at about 8:50 p.m. Thursday and determined that the suspects were shooting firearms.
Officers from Winfield, Warrenville and Glendale Heights police departments also responded.
A search warrant executed at the apartment building uncovered two firearms.
No injuries were reported.
